What is an underwriting assistant?

An underwriting assistant, or underwriting service assistant, helps a lead underwriter to process applications for mortgages, credit, or insurance. Whether you work in the banking or insurance industry, your primary responsibility is to support your company’s underwriters. This includes obtaining relevant documents and client information so that the underwriter can assess their eligibility, and maintaining accurate records on all applicants and approval processes. Since you often work directly under a single underwriter, specific duties vary depending on your supervisors working style. You need an associate degree in finance or economics for a career as an underwriting assistant, but most employers prefer candidates to hold a bachelor’s degree. Organizational and administrative skills are crucial for this field.

What is the difference between Underwriting Assistant vs Insurance Underwriter?

AspectUnderwriting AssistantInsurance Underwriter
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require insurance licenses or certificationsBachelor's degree in finance, business, or related field; professional certifications like CPCU are common
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, supporting underwriting teams, handling administrative tasksOffice environment, analyzing risk, making coverage decisions
Job ResponsibilitiesData entry, document review, assisting underwriters, preparing reportsAssessing risk, approving or denying insurance applications, setting premiums

While both roles are integral to the insurance industry, an Underwriting Assistant primarily provides administrative and support functions, whereas an Insurance Underwriter makes critical risk assessments and coverage decisions. The Underwriting Assistant supports the underwriting process, enabling underwriters to focus on evaluating risks and setting policies.

Is underwriting a tough job?

Underwriting is a detail-oriented role that involves assessing risks and making decisions based on financial and personal information. It can be challenging due to the need for accuracy, compliance with regulations, and sometimes tight deadlines, but it also offers opportunities for skill development and career growth.
